Dion calls for better planning

National, Normal
Source:

The National, Thursday 9th May 2013

 DEPUTY Prime Minister Leo Dion says there must be an improvement in the coordination of activities in government departments and agencies to planning, budgeting, resource allocation and monitoring.

He told civil servants that this would improve public service delivery.

The public servants were attending the New Guinea Islands Consultative workshop on leadership, human resource management, financial management, procurement and project management in Kokopo.

Dion, the Minister for Inter-government Relations, said performance outcomes must be set across sectors especially at the provincial and local level government levels.

“The Department of Treasury on the other hand must allocate appropriate funding to those priority activities and ensure that these funds are released on a timely basis to support implementation,” Dion said.

“The government will continue to insist that strict fiscal discipline is exercised to ensure effective implementation of annual budgets and to avoid diversion of funds without going through the normal budget review processes.”
